Elements is a web application designed for musicians, producers, and
composers who want a fast and intuitive way to create chord progressions,
explore scales, and experiment with musical harmony directly in the browser.
With Elements, you can build chord progressions using a powerful 16-pad
workspace designed for speed and creativity. Each pad represents a chord slot,
allowing you to design and test harmonic ideas quickly. Experiment with different
chord progression models, modify chords instantly, and hear results in real time.
The platform combines practical music theory tools with an intuitive interface,
helping you explore new musical directions without interrupting your creative workflow.
Intervals:module
Build musical intervals instantly with the Interval Constructor in Elements.
Select a root note using the visual piano keyboard, your computer keyboard,
or a connected MIDI controller, then choose an interval type to generate the notes automatically.
The module instantly calculates and displays the interval structure, helping you
understand how notes relate within harmony. You can listen to the interval in real time,
visualize it on the keyboard, and save it to your personal library for later use.
Perfect for learning music theory, designing chord structures, and
experimenting with harmonic relationships, the Interval Constructor
makes it easy to explore intervals and use them as building blocks for chords and progressions.
Scaler:module
The Scale Constructor module in Elements helps you explore and
generate musical scales instantly. Choose a root note using the
on-screen piano, your computer keyboard, or a
connected MIDI controller, then select a scale type to automatically build the complete scale.
Elements displays all notes of the scale across the keyboard so you can clearly see the
harmonic structure and tonal relationships. You can play the scale, analyze its notes,
and save it to your personal library for quick access in future sessions.
This tool is ideal for music producers, composers, and music theory learners who want to
understand scales, create harmonic foundations, improvise and build chord progressions
directly from scale structures.
Chords:module
The Chord Constructor module allows you to quickly build and explore chords
from any root note. Select a note using the on-screen piano,
your computer keyboard, or a connected MIDI controller, then choose a chord
type to instantly generate the chord structure.
Elements highlights all chord tones directly on the keyboard,
making it easy to visualize intervals and understand how the
chord is built. You can listen to the chord, analyze its notes,
and save it to your personal library for later use.
This tool helps music producers, composers, and songwriters experiment
with harmony, discover new chord ideas, and quickly build the foundation for chord
progressions and musical arrangements.
Progressor:module
The Progression Builder module allows you to quickly create and experiment with chord
progressions in any key and scale. Choose your root note, select a scale,
and apply common progression patterns like 1–5–6–4 or build your own sequence from scratch.
Elements automatically generates the corresponding chords and displays them across
interactive pads, making it easy to arrange, modify, and test different
harmonic ideas. Each chord is visualized on the keyboard, helping you clearly see the
notes and intervals within the progression.
You can play back your progression in real time, tweak individual chords, save your favorite
sequences and download in .midi for future use in DAW. With MIDI and keyboard input support,
the workflow feels natural and responsive.
This tool helps producers, composers, and musicians quickly explore harmonic structures,
discover new musical ideas, and build complete
chord progressions for tracks, sound design, and live performance.

Visualize

Multi platform

Detector
A visual piano keyboard lets you see
exactly which notes are being played
in your chords and scales. You can
instantly preview every chord using the
built-in high-quality piano audio engine.
Design progressions in the browser, export them
instantly, and integrate them into your music projects without friction.
The Detector module allows you to
instantly identify intervals,
scales or chords from
incoming MIDI or keyboard input.
Elements supports MIDI controller input,
allowing you to interact with the app
using your favorite MIDI keyboard.
Save custom chord progressions.
Store scales and interval sets
Organize musical ideas in one place
*for registered users
Share progressions with other musicians around the world
Every progression you create can be
exported as a .MIDI file, making it
easy to import directly into
your preferred DAW and continue production.
Elements
is ideal for:
- Music producers
- Songwriters
- Composers
- Music theory learners
- Electronic music creators
- Anyone looking for fast harmonic inspiration
Whether you are sketching song ideas, studying
harmony, or building progressions for a track,
Elements provides a powerful and streamlined
environment for musical creativity.